  • http://unfccc.int/index.html UNITED NATIONS FRAMEWORK CONVENTION ON CLIMATE CHANGE and its 1997 Kyoto Protocol are the key processes for negotiating international climate policies and reductions in greenhouse gas emissions. The latest (November 2001) round of negotiations, http://www.unfccc.int/cop7 the seventh conference of the parties to the convention , finalized the operational details of the Kyoto Protocol, opening the way to ratification and the Protocol's entry into force.
